  • It’s not shocking that all the time you spend with an iPhone pressed against your cheek isn’t great for your skin. After all, everyone knows that dirty, oily screens can lead to pimples. But what is surprising is that cell phones can also lead to saggy “tech neck” (basically turkey neck caused from craning your head) and crow’s feet. [StyleCaster]
  • In the latest crazy shakeup in the global fashion world, Raf Simons is stepping down from his post as creative director of Dior’s women’s collections. (Cue major freakouts.) One likely successor: Riccardo Tisci of Givenchy.  [WWD]

  • Levi’s and Pendleton have collaborated on a limited-edition line of winter pieces for men, including a wool-denim work shirt lined with Pendleton’s signature blanket material, a blanket-lined denim jacket and a great winter blanket. Guys, I highly recommend the jacket. [GQ]
